摘要
Background: Recent studies report the incidence of axillary metastases in patients with ductal carcinoma in-situ (DCIS) approaches 13%. The purpose of this study was to define the incidence of axillary micrometastases in patients with pure DCIS before and after the introduction of sentinel lymph node biopsy. Methods: Patients with a final diagnosis of DCIS form the basis of this study. Data were entered prospectively into an Institutional Review Board approved Oracle, database from January 1997 through July 2002. Results: One hundred and thirty-four patients had lymph nodes evaluated. Ninety-eight percent of patients had no evidence of metastatic disease and 2% were found to have micrometastases. This was consistent in those who, had level I or II lymph node sampling or both and those who had lymphatic mapping and a sentinel lymph node biopsy procedure. Conclusions: These data do not support axillary lymph node removal of any type in patients with pure DCIS. (C) 2003 Excerpta Medica, Inc. All rights reserved.
